Connect Adjunct Power

The 400B2 adapter is convenient for connecting local -48 VDC power to a modular plug. See
''400B2 Adapter Connecting to a Modular Plug'' on page
Each port network can provide power for up to three attendant consoles. This source of power is
preferred for the attendant consoles because it has the same battery backup as the media
gateway. See
''Auxiliary Connector Outputs (MCC1 and SCC1 media gateways only)'' on page
172.
